When Watson takes Holmes to Surrey to recover from exhaustion, they expect a peaceful retreat. But trouble soon catches up with the mystery-solving duo after a shocking murder occurs at a nearby estate. Behind the respectable facades of the county's great houses, dangerous secrets lurk. A single scrap of paper may hold the key to unravelling the truth, but can Holmes decipher its meaning before another victim is claimed? A Noiser podcast production.
